Key Insights

  • 😨 Fear-based tactics are often used on YouTube to promote gold investments, but it's important to approach investing from a long-term perspective.
  • 🛀 Gold prices have shown historical volatility, making it difficult to predict future trends accurately.
  • 🏅 The cost curve for gold mining indicates potential oversupply if prices continue to rise, impacting gold prices in the long term.
  • ✋ Investing in gold miners can provide more leverage but comes with higher risks.
  • ✳️ Balancing risk is crucial, as higher gold prices increase the risk, but being a contrarian investor can provide opportunities for success.
  • 🏅 Dividends and yields are not offered by gold, and storage costs should be considered.
  • 🇨🇷 Examining the cost production and understanding the fundamentals is essential when analyzing any commodity.

Questions & Answers

Q: Why is there so much hype around investing in gold on YouTube?

Fear is an easy sell, and YouTube channels that promote gold investments often benefit from commission on buying, trading, and selling gold. These channels use fear tactics to sell gold as a hedge against economic uncertainties.

Q: Can gold be a better investment than stocks in the long term?

While gold has experienced significant price increases over time, stocks have also outperformed gold and offer the additional benefit of dividends. It's important to consider the historical price trends and risk/reward perspective when comparing the two.

Q: What factors influence the price of gold?

People's behavior, such as rushing to buy or sell gold, plays a crucial role in gold price fluctuations. Additionally, economic factors, inflation, and central bank actions can impact gold prices.

Q: What should I consider when investing in gold miners?

Investing in gold mining companies can offer more leverage to gold price changes, but it also comes with higher risks. It's essential to analyze their production costs, leverage, and exposure to gold before making investment decisions.

Summary & Key Takeaways

  • There has been recent excitement about gold prices increasing, but it's important to approach investing in gold from a long-term risk/reward perspective.

  • Gold prices have shown historical volatility, with periods of decline and spikes in price, making it difficult to predict future trends.

  • The cost curve for gold mining shows that the average production cost is around $1,080 per ounce, suggesting potential oversupply if prices continue to rise.
